Product Introduction

Overview

The CD74HC273MG4, produced by Texas Instruments, is a high-speed octal D-Type flip-flop integrated circuit with a direct clear input. It is manufactured using silicon-gate CMOS technology, which ensures low power consumption similar to standard CMOS integrated circuits. This device features eight D-Type flip-flops controlled by a common clock (CLK) and a common reset (CLR). The information at the D input is transferred to the Q outputs on the positive-going edge of the clock pulse. Resetting is accomplished by a low voltage level independent of the clock, resetting all eight Q outputs to a logic 0.

Key Features

  • Common clock and asynchronous controller reset
  • Positive edge triggering
  • Buffered inputs
  • Fanout capability: Standard outputs support 10 LSTTL loads, bus driver outputs support 15 LSTTL loads
  • Wide operating temperature range: -55℃ to 125℃
  • Balanced propagation delay and transition times
  • Significant power reduction compared to LSTTL logic ICs
  • HC types: 2 V to 6 V operation, high noise immunity (NIL = 30%, NIH = 30% of VCC at VCC = 5V)
  • HCT types: 4.5 V to 5.5 V operation, direct LSTTL input logic compatibility, CMOS input compatibility
